Lengthening of congenital lower limb shortness with the methods of Ilizarov

Abstract

32 patients with congenital shortness of the lower extremity were treated in Baku Ortopedic and Traumatologic Scientific Research Institute between 1985-1992 utilising the Ilizarov methods. The patients were between the ages of 3-12 with a shortness of 3 to 12 cm. The shortness was in the femur in 10 patients and tibia in 22. Complications encountered in this series were equinus deformity of the foot in 2 patients, flexion deformity of the knee in 2 patients, 4 deep pin tract infection and one deformity in the regenerate following fixator removal. According to our results we think that the methods developed by Ilizarov consisting of corticotomy and circular fixator application is perfectly suitable for congenital lower limb shortness.
